Went here as a party of four. We all had pasta dishes accompanied with three sides. This is the best pasta I’ve ever had in Taunton. Freshly made, cooked to perfection. My carbonara was brilliant. For £6.99 this is incredible value. Soft drinks are available but we took our own wine and were not charged corkage. Another major plus. With dessert, the bill was less than £35.00. For food of this quality the prices are incredible. The sorroundings are very basic and a few pictures on the walls will improve things but it’s early days yet. Please note it is cash only for the time being. We will certainly return. Five stars well earned.

We had read about this place in our local newspaper and thought it sounded very interesting. Reviews on Facebook were all excellent and so four of us visited on Saturday evening. A quiet night in town as there was live music in Vivary Park! This place has concentrated on takeaway food but does have limited seating. There is no alcohol licence but the owner was happy for us to take our own wine. We also took our own glasses and amazingly no corkage was charged - unlike one unlicensed restaurant in Taunton that charged £2 per person! We had a main course each and three of us took advantage of the special offer - a side and drink for £2. For mains we had two Formaggio Maccharoni, one Con Gamberetti Tagliolini and one Alla Carbonara. Our sides were onion rings, garlic bread and potato wedges. We shared a desert of Cocobella with caramel sauce - delicious. With three cans of pepsi max our bill was £34.95. The owner was helpful, friendly and the pasta was perfect. All freshly cooked, piping hot and very tasty. This establishment really deserves to succeed - it is good to have quality food at very reasonable prices with no pretention, corkage or service charge. If they do well they may expand into upstairs and turn it into a full blown restaurant, rather than a takeaway with seating - this is where the Mexican restaurant was and so there is plenty of room. Most definitely worth a visit either for a takeaway or meal in.
